  • Abstract:
    A system for producing a contrast-enhanced medical image of a patient includes a source of a contrast or enhancement medium, a pressurizing unit in fluid connection with the source of contrast or enhancement medium, an energy source operable to apply energy to a region of the patient, an imaging unit providing a visual display of an internal view of the patient based upon a signal resulting from the energy applied to the region of the patient, and a control unit. In an embodiment, the signal is affected by a condition of the contrast or enhancement medium in the patient. To control the procedures, the control unit adjusts the condition of the contrast or enhancement medium in the patient based upon the signal. A communication interface preferably enables information between an injector subsystem and an imaging subsystem.

  • Abstract:
    An interface unit enables communication with an injector system that is used for pressurizing a fluid medium for injection into a patient during an injection procedure. The interface unit includes a processor and a storage unit. The processor controls operation of the interface unit and enables exchange of digital information between the interface unit and the injector system. The storage unit, under control of the processor, records the digital information gathered from the injector system during communication therewith. The digital information includes at least injection profile, history and dose data pertaining to the injection procedure. The processor enables at least the injection profile, history and dose data of the digital information recorded within the storage unit of the interface unit to be communicable to at least one of an imaging system linked thereto and an external device linked thereto.
